Congregational Administrator The Unitarian Society of New Haven 700 Hartford Turnpike, Hamden CT 06517
The Unitarian Society of New Haven (USNH) is a liberal religious congregation with approximately 325 adult members. We are a diverse multi-generational faith community that inspires lives of compassion and generosity, nurtures spiritual growth, cultivates transformative connections, and works to create a more just world. We seek a highly motivated and experienced person to manage the business affairs and ensure smooth operation of our active and engaged congregation. www.USNH.org
Responsibilities:
– Works closely with Senior Minister and lay leaders to ensure accurate and effective administration of congregational life.
– Manages financial and administrative functions of the congregation, including QuickBooks, accounting, and payroll in collaboration with paid staff and volunteers.
– Manages facilities maintenance, rental, and usage.
– Supervises administrative and facilities staff and oversees personnel salary and benefits with a high level of professionalism and confidentiality.
– Develops and maintains multiple pathways for communication among leaders, membership, and the wider community, including website, print, newsletters, email updates, and social media.
– Evaluates and prioritizes administrative functions and readily delegates to paid staff and volunteers.
– Recruits, trains, supervises, and supports volunteers, using initiative and creativity.
– Provides a high-level of professionalism, collaboration, and communication in the church office while serving as a point-of-contact for people both inside and outside the congregation.
Qualifications:
– College degree and 2-5 years’ experience in organization administration and office management.
– Experience with QuickBooks, payroll services, database software, and accounting functions.
– Supervisory and volunteer coordination experience.
– Excellent verbal and written communication skills, including use of websites and social media.
– Ability to plan, organize and prioritize work while managing multiple projects simultaneously and working accurately with attention to detail. Capable of working independently and as part of a team of professional staff and lay leaders.
– Ability to work effectively, comfortably, and energetically with people from diverse backgrounds.
– Experience with computers and office and financial management software, including Word, Excel, QuickBooks, database management software, web management, email communications, social media, and networking; skillful adopter of new technologies.
– Satisfactory criminal background and reference checks.
– Preference given for experience with management of faith communities or nonprofits. Prior experience with Unitarian Universalism not required. Not open to congregation members.
Hours: Full-time salaried position (40 hours/week) with benefits. Requires occasional evening and weekend hours. We will also consider structuring the job to 30 hrs/week with pro-rated benefits.
Reporting: The Congregational Administrator reports to the Senior Minister
Salary: Dependent on experience. (Within UUA Fair Compensation Guidelines)
